// GENERATED CONTENT - DO NOT EDIT
// Content was automatically extracted by Reffy into webref
// (https://github.com/w3c/webref)
// Source: Web Animations Level 2 (https://drafts.csswg.org/web-animations-2/)
[Exposed=Window]
partial interface AnimationTimeline {
readonly attribute CSSNumberish? currentTime;
readonly attribute CSSNumberish? duration;
Animation play (optional AnimationEffect? effect = null);
};
[Exposed=Window]
partial interface Animation {
attribute CSSNumberish? startTime;
attribute CSSNumberish? currentTime;
attribute AnimationTrigger? trigger;
readonly attribute double? overallProgress;
};
[Exposed=Window]
partial interface AnimationEffect {
// Timing hierarchy
readonly attribute GroupEffect? parent;
readonly attribute AnimationEffect? previousSibling;
readonly attribute AnimationEffect? nextSibling;
undefined before (AnimationEffect... effects);
undefined after (AnimationEffect... effects);
undefined replace (AnimationEffect... effects);
undefined remove ();
};
partial dictionary EffectTiming {
double delay;
double endDelay;
double playbackRate = 1.0;
(unrestricted double or CSSNumericValue or DOMString) duration = "auto";
};
partial dictionary OptionalEffectTiming {
double playbackRate;
};
partial dictionary ComputedEffectTiming {
CSSNumberish startTime;
CSSNumberish endTime;
CSSNumberish activeDuration;
CSSNumberish? localTime;
};
[Exposed=Window]
interface GroupEffect {
constructor(sequence<AnimationEffect>? children,
optional (unrestricted double or EffectTiming) timing = {});
readonly attribute AnimationNodeList children;
readonly attribute AnimationEffect? firstChild;
readonly attribute AnimationEffect? lastChild;
GroupEffect clone ();
undefined prepend (AnimationEffect... effects);
undefined append (AnimationEffect... effects);
};
[Exposed=Window]
interface AnimationNodeList {
readonly attribute unsigned long length;
getter AnimationEffect? item (unsigned long index);
};
[Exposed=Window]
interface SequenceEffect : GroupEffect {
constructor(sequence<AnimationEffect>? children,
optional (unrestricted double or EffectTiming) timing = {});
SequenceEffect clone ();
};
partial interface KeyframeEffect {
attribute IterationCompositeOperation iterationComposite;
};
partial dictionary KeyframeEffectOptions {
IterationCompositeOperation iterationComposite = "replace";
};
enum IterationCompositeOperation { "replace", "accumulate" };
callback EffectCallback = undefined (double? progress,
(Element or CSSPseudoElement) currentTarget,
Animation animation);
dictionary TimelineRangeOffset {
CSSOMString? rangeName;
CSSNumericValue offset;
};
partial dictionary KeyframeAnimationOptions {
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) rangeStart = "normal";
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) rangeEnd = "normal";
AnimationTrigger? trigger;
};
[Exposed=Window]
interface AnimationPlaybackEvent : Event {
constructor(DOMString type, optional AnimationPlaybackEventInit
eventInitDict = {});
readonly attribute CSSNumberish? currentTime;
readonly attribute CSSNumberish? timelineTime;
};
dictionary AnimationPlaybackEventInit : EventInit {
CSSNumberish? currentTime = null;
CSSNumberish? timelineTime = null;
};
[Exposed=Window]
interface AnimationTrigger {
constructor(optional AnimationTriggerOptions options = {});
attribute AnimationTimeline timeline;
attribute AnimationTriggerBehavior behavior;
attribute any rangeStart;
attribute any rangeEnd;
attribute any exitRangeStart;
attribute any exitRangeEnd;
};
dictionary AnimationTriggerOptions {
AnimationTimeline? timeline;
AnimationTriggerBehavior? behavior = "once";
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) rangeStart = "normal";
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) rangeEnd = "normal";
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) exitRangeStart = "auto";
(TimelineRangeOffset or CSSNumericValue or CSSKeywordValue or DOMString) exitRangeEnd = "auto";
};
enum AnimationTriggerBehavior { "once", "repeat", "alternate", "state" };
